0

我正在尝试下载文档并为此使用文档列表 api。从https://docs.google.com/feeds/default/private/full获取文件并对其进行迭代,获取下载文件的入口。大部分文档都可以正常下载,但其中一部分会引发 ResourceNotFoundException,这里是跟踪:

at
 com.google.gdata.client.http.HttpGDataRequest.handleErrorResponse(HttpGDataRequest.java:591)
 at
 com.google.gdata.client.http.GoogleGDataRequest.handleErrorResponse(GoogleGDataRequest.java:563)
  at
 com.google.gdata.client.http.HttpGDataRequest.checkResponse(HttpGDataRequest.java:552)
  at
 com.google.gdata.client.http.HttpGDataRequest.execute(HttpGDataRequest.java:530)
  at
 com.google.gdata.client.http.GoogleGDataRequest.execute(GoogleGDataRequest.java:535)
  at
 com.google.gdata.client.media.MediaService.getMediaResource(MediaService.java:234)
  at
 com.google.gdata.client.media.MediaService.getMedia(MediaService.java:276)
  at
 com.google.gdata.client.media.MediaService.getMedia(MediaService.java:302)

异常文本是:

 com.google.gdata.util.ResourceNotFoundException: Not Found

然后是 Google html 页面。

有没有想过如何解决这个问题?

4

1 回答 1

0

不确定每行末尾的这些数字是做什么的,但如果它们是文档的某种 ID,则可能是您的问题所在。因为根据您的错误消息,我认为您尝试访问的文档不存在。

于 2012-09-16T15:57:01.183 回答